## Configuration

Digestwren batches outbound email digests on a cron-style schedule. Set `DIGEST_CRON` in your plugin's env file; default is hourly. Plugins may override the window with `DIGEST_WINDOW_MIN`, capped at 1440. Invalid schedules fall back to daily at 06:00 UTC and log a warning. Before digests can actually send, the relay credential must be present, so add it directly below this line.

sealed setting: VAULT_KEY20=c8ea1e419912889df6b4

TICKET #—Missed pick-up, Bay 2

Torvik Freight missed yesterday's 14:00 collection of the Arnwell gauge crates. We have reassigned the job to Lanneret Couriers, arriving today between 10:00 and 11:00. Same manifest, same crate count. Have the crates staged at Bay 2 by 09:45. The replacement courier's confidential hand-over instruction is below.

courier memo of fahag-badug: the norys istion courier leaves the zoriel ledger at gate 4000 under passcode 457370

// Fixture: resolver batching for the Quennet order graph.
// Before the fix, each OrderLine resolved its Vendor with a
// separate query — classic N+1, ~400 queries per page load.
// We now batch through VendorLoader; this fixture asserts
// exactly two queries fire. Don't mock the loader itself or
// the test proves nothing. Runs against the staging gateway at
// Harlow Mills. Auth uses the token below.

session JWT of yawep-yawep = eyJhbGciOiJIUzI1NiIsInR5cCI6IkpXVCJ9.eyJzdWIiOiI3pWF3_In0.aXYsHiog

Artifacts are reproducible: same tag, same output hash. The release manager must confirm three things before promotion: the signing step ran on the sealed builder, the dependency lockfile matched the audited snapshot, and the unit-conversion tables were regenerated from source. No manual artifact uploads are permitted. Provenance records are retained for two years. Each promoted build carries a trace token, recorded directly below this line.

build token for tahop-fafof: htk14_2d55df8101eccc